Two arrested in Winston-Salem shooting that injured man, juvenile: Police

WINSTON-SALEM, N.C. — Two people have been arrested in connection with a February 21 shooting on Lambeth Street that injured a 42-year-old man and a juvenile, the Winston-Salem Police Department said.

Police responded to 3335 Lambeth Street at 4:21 p.m. the day of the shooting and found a man with a gunshot wound and a juvenile with a graze wound. Both victims received immediate medical attention.

The man was taken to a local hospital with non-life-threatening injuries, while the juvenile was treated on the scene…
